摘要: 在超声分子束中,使用双光子共振电离光谱技术和飞行时间质谱技术研究了复合物邻二甲苯…Ar,N2,NH3(ND3).通过理论计算及同位素光谱效应,合理地归属了这些复合物的光谱,并由此获得这些复合物分子间各种模式的振动频率.

Abstract: Resonant two-photon ionization spectra of van der Waals complexes C6H4(CH3)2:Ar, N2, NH3were reported by using one-color resonant ionization technique, together with time-of-flight mass spectrometry, in supersonic molecular beam. All observed bands were rationally assigned by calculated levels, isotope effect, and spectral analysis. According to the spectra assignment, the frequencies of van der waals vibrations for these complexes were obtained.
